The accident took place Saturday evening.

(Osgood, Ind.) – One person was injured in a vehicle versus train accident.
Ripley County Sheriff’s deputies responded to the accident on Saturday around 6:00 p.m. at the intersection of Sycamore Street and Railroad Avenue.
Upon arrival, deputies found Diane Vest, 67, of Osgood, entrapped in her vehicle.
Vest had been traveling north on Sycamore Street when she entered the railroad crossing into the path of an eastbound CSX train.
Vest had to be extricated from her vehicle, and was airlifted to UC Medical Center with unknown injuries.
Ripley County EMS, Ripley County Medic and Osgood Fire assisted at the scene.
